Liverpool are reportedly in contact with a £148m footballer's representatives ahead of a possible massive move to Anfield in the summer transfer window.

Liverpool in need of a new striker
The Reds may currently be cruising towards the Premier League title, but that's not to say that Arne Slot won't be eyeing important signings in various areas of the pitch this summer.

Centre forward is surely a position that the Dutchman will be focusing on, with question marks surrounding the long-term worth of Luis Diaz, Darwin Nunz and Diogo Jota currently.

Diaz has often been deployed centrally for Liverpool this season, with Cody Gakpo starring on the left wing, and while the Colombian has done well at times, he hasn't looked completely at home there. Now 28, there is a chance that the Merseysiders could look to cash in on him at the end of the season, with Chelsea and Barcelona believed to be interested.

Meanwhile, Nunez hasn't developed enough as a player in the three seasons since joining the Reds in 2022, too often proving to be wasteful in front of goal, and while Jota is arguably his side's best finisher when he is fit, he is sidelined through injury far too often.

Liverpool in contact with Isak's agents ahead of possible £148m move
According to Sky Sports journalist Sacha Tavolieri, Liverpool are in contact with Newcastle United striker Alexander Isak's representatives over a stunning move to Anfield this summer. FSG are claimed to be ready to "break away from their usual strategies to score a huge blow",

The Reds will have to pay an eye-watering £148m to get their man, however, which would smash the club's transfer record by some distance, with the £85m paid for Nunez the current highest amount paid for a player.

The prospect of Isak in a Liverpool shirt is mouthwatering, considering the Swede has stood out as one of Europe's top strikers this season.

The 25-year-old has been electric for Newcastle, scoring 19 goals in 24 appearances in the Premier League, one of which came in the 3-3 draw at home to the Reds back in December, when he thundered a finish past Caoimhin Kelleher. Alan Shearer knows a thing or two about what makes a top striker, and he hailed Isak last season, saying:

"He is confident and cool and believes in everything he is doing. We know that once he gets away over the top, he is going to cause you an absolute nightmare. His ability to link up and his understanding [is brilliant]. Everything about his game is of the highest quality. He has scored 19 goals in 23 games - that is a very, very good record."

Isak's price tag is clearly a potential stumbling block, considering spending £148m on any player is a risk, especially as the Sweden international has had injury problems, missing last week's trip to Anfield, for example.
